In addition to our community food garden plots, the campus of St. Mary’s is blessed with beautiful flower gardens that brighten the grounds all spring and summer long. They are lovingly tended by a group of dedicated voluteers – if you stop by during a weekday morning, you may see some of them weeding or pruning the flowerbeds or bushes.
In the summer of 2024, we planted berry bushes and fruit trees – “Art’s Orchard”, named for homesteader Art Waldron, whose family donated the land on which St. Mary’s was built – on our campus. These trees and bushes provide beauty, food, and restful oases to visitors, and are also educational, as each plant features a QR-code link to a page about its species.
